    The Willis Tower, originally and still commonly referred to as the Sears Tower, is a 110-story, 1,451-foot (442.3 m) skyscraper in the Loop community area of Chicago in Illinois, United States.

  6. Jul 3, 2024 · Willis Tower, skyscraper office building in Chicago, Illinois, located at 233 South Wacker Drive, that is one of the world’s tallest buildings. The Sears Tower opened to tenants in 1973, though construction was not actually completed until 1974.

  7. At Skydeck, you can smoothly rocket to the top of Willis Tower at 24 feet per second, climbing 1,353 feet in one minute flat. Take in panoramic vistas of the iconic skyline, Lake Michigan and up to four states – Michigan, Indiana, Wisconsin and Illinois.
